- The U.S. Census Bureau: This is the primary source for population data in the United States. You can find detailed information on the census website. They provide data at various levels, including the town, county, and state. The Census Bureau conducts a full census every ten years. They also conduct annual surveys, such as the American Community Survey (ACS), that provide more up-to-date information on demographics and other characteristics.

Diving into the Demographics of Ieverett
Beyond just the raw numbers, the demographics of Ieverett, Pennsylvania, tell a much richer story. Demographics break down the population by various characteristics, such as age, race, ethnicity, and income. Think of it as painting a detailed portrait of the community! Understanding the demographics gives you a much better picture of the people who make up Ieverett. For example, knowing the age distribution helps you get a sense of whether it's a town with a lot of young families, a mix of age groups, or a place where older residents tend to settle. The age breakdown is usually shown in age brackets, like the number of people under 18, the number between 18 and 65, and the number over 65.
Race and ethnicity data give you insights into the cultural diversity of the town. Is it a melting pot, or is it more homogenous? You’ll see the percentages of different racial and ethnic groups within the population. This information can be really valuable for understanding community dynamics, the availability of various cultural resources, and the overall social fabric of the town. It’s also important for understanding the economic landscape of the area because different ethnic groups might have different economic opportunities and outcomes, which can affect things like homeownership and employment rates.
Income levels are another crucial piece of the demographic puzzle. The median household income and the poverty rate give you a sense of the economic well-being of the residents. Is the town generally prosperous, or are many people struggling to make ends meet? Income data are super important for understanding the challenges and opportunities that residents face. It often correlates with other factors like education levels, healthcare access, and housing costs. High poverty rates might indicate a need for social services and economic development initiatives. Higher income levels might indicate more thriving local businesses, better schools, and a higher quality of life. The median household income will show you the midpoint of all household incomes. The poverty rate tells you the percentage of the population that is below the poverty line, which is determined by the federal government based on family size and income.
Education levels also contribute to the demographic profile. The percentage of people with a high school diploma, a bachelor's degree, or advanced degrees indicates the educational attainment of the town's residents. This can tell you a lot about the skills and qualifications of the local workforce and the types of jobs available in the area. Higher education levels often correlate with higher incomes and better employment opportunities. It can also be an indicator of the community's overall focus on learning and development. If the town has a large population with advanced degrees, it might attract high-tech companies or other businesses that require a skilled workforce.
The Significance of Population Data for Ieverett
So, why should you care about the Ieverett Pennsylvania population and all the demographic details? Well, it's pretty important, honestly! This data is super valuable for a bunch of reasons, and here’s why.
First off, local government officials use population data to make informed decisions about resource allocation. Think about it: they need to plan for things like schools, roads, public transportation, and emergency services. Knowing how many people live in a town, where they live, and their age distribution is crucial for forecasting future needs and ensuring that the community has the right resources at the right time. For example, if a town has a growing number of young families, they might need to invest in building more schools or expanding childcare services. Or, if the population is aging, they might need to increase healthcare facilities and senior services.
Businesses also rely on population data. They use it to understand the market and target their products and services effectively. If a town has a large population of young professionals, you might see more coffee shops, co-working spaces, and trendy restaurants popping up. Understanding the demographics can also help businesses tailor their marketing campaigns to specific groups. For example, they might use different advertising strategies to reach different age groups or ethnic communities. Retailers and other businesses study population data to identify ideal locations for their stores. They’ll look at population density, income levels, and the types of people who live in an area to assess whether a new location makes sense.
For anyone considering moving to Ieverett, Pennsylvania, population and demographic data is a goldmine of information. It can help you make a well-informed decision about whether the town is a good fit for you and your family. If you're looking for a town with good schools, knowing the number of school-aged children in the population can give you a better sense of the local education system's resources and opportunities. Knowing the average income and the cost of housing will help you understand the affordability of living in Ieverett. The demographics can also shed light on the town’s social and cultural environment. If you want to live in a diverse community or a town with a strong sense of community, knowing the racial and ethnic makeup can give you a clue about whether Ieverett is the right place for you. It helps you assess if the town meets your personal and professional needs.
Finally, for researchers and urban planners, population data provides a critical foundation for analyzing trends, evaluating the effectiveness of programs, and making recommendations for community improvement. They use population data to study issues like housing affordability, environmental sustainability, and public health. This data can inform policies that promote economic development, improve quality of life, and address social inequalities. For instance, urban planners might use population data to analyze traffic patterns and recommend infrastructure improvements to reduce congestion. Researchers might use population data to evaluate the impact of a new public health program on a specific demographic group.
